The ARCS provided non-food assistance to 1,000 repatriated families in various districts of Farah City in Farah Province.

Each family received two blankets, along with clothing for men, women, and children, including jumpers, underwear, gloves, socks, scarves, shoes, and other essential items.

The assistance was provided to help meet the essential needs of the families.

ARCS continues to provide similar humanitarian aid to support repatriated families and improve their living conditions.
